Quantity Surveyor

We are looking for an experienced Quantity Surveyor with an Architectural Engineering background and over 7 years of proven expertise in cost management, estimation, and contract administration. The ideal candidate will bring strong technical and financial skills to deliver cost-efficient solutions while maintaining design quality and project standards.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and review detailed cost estimates, BOQs, tender documents, and contract agreements.

  • Lead feasibility studies, value engineering, and cost control measures across all project phases.

  • Evaluate architectural and engineering drawings for accuracy, scope, and cost implications.

  • Manage procurement, tendering, and contractor negotiations.

  • Monitor project budgets, variations, and prepare regular cost and financial reports.

  • Conduct site inspections to verify progress, validate claims, and prepare interim/final valuations.

  • Support dispute resolution, claims assessment, and final account settlements.

  • Ensure compliance with local regulations, codes, and international best practices.

  • Collaborate closely with architects, engineers, and project managers to align design and cost efficiency.

Qualifications & Skills: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Quantity Surveying, Architectural Engineering, or a related field.

  • Minimum 7+ years of professional experience in cost estimation, quantity surveying, and contract management.

  • Professional accreditation (RICS, MRICS, or equivalent) preferred.

  • Strong knowledge of architectural design, construction techniques, and material specifications.

  • Proficiency in cost management tools (e.g., Candy, CostX, Primavera, AutoCAD, Revit).

  • Strong analytical, negotiation, and leadership skills.

  • Experience in large-scale projects (commercial, residential, or mixed-use).

  • GCC/Middle East project exposure is an advantage.
